**Ticket #482 — resizely CLI broken on staging**

Hey on-call: the resizely batch image resizer is failing on staging because someone copied the prod env over without the upload token. Batch jobs die immediately with a 401 from the Pixelbarn store. Fix is quick — open the staging env file and add the following line.

sealed setting: VAULT_KEY20=69e2a0b23f1a79fbf692

Plugins that contribute
# custom pruning rules should not write to the findings store
# directly; instead, emit results through the reporting hook and let
# the core engine batch them. During local development, however, you
# may need direct read access to inspect stored layer digests and
# verify that your rule fired. For that purpose, connect your
# inspection tooling to the findings database using the connection
# string below.

primary connection of yagep-kahip = redis://giliel_svc:zYiKsLL2PLpfPL@db-348f.xolmarsys.corp:5432/fenwyn

## Changelog — Ticktrace 1.9

### Renamed: DRIFT_API_TOKEN
During the cron drift investigation we found plugins confusing this variable with the metrics token, so it has been renamed to indicate it authorizes drift-report uploads specifically. Plugin authors must read the new name from 1.9 onward; the old name is ignored without warning. Sample env files in the SDK are updated. In your deployment env file, the drift-report upload secret is set on the next line.

env line for fawef-taguf: VAULT_KEY13=a9695905a9a90